Now, if we add a Fregat atop the KVTK (heavy payload for the "poor little" ProtonM
)
I assume a LM of 10 tons for now
Dv1 = 4542.03 * ln(24000+6400+10000/4400+6400+10000)
Dv1 = 4542.03 * ln(40400/20800)
Dv1 = 3015.34 m/s ; velocity gain at the end of the KVTK burn
Dv2 = 3256.92 * ln(6400+10000/11050)
Dv2 = 1285.99 m/s ; additional gain of velocity after the Fregat burn.
DvT = Dv1 + Dv2
DvT = 3015.34 + 1285.99
DvT = 4301.33 m/s ; total velocity gain of our 10-tons payload after the burns.
So, on the paper a 10-tons LM is go for the Lunar Orbit ! But we have to consider that the KVTK will need to perform a burn for LEO insertion (because the KVTK+Fregat stack is well over the ProtonM payload capacity).
If we are really too short on Dv, there's an alternative that need another launch :
Launch 1 : Send a LM in LLO that has just enough propellant for the final landing phase and the ascent phase.
Launch 2 : Send a Fregat in LLO.
Launch 3 : Send a "Fregat2" in LLO
Launch 4 : Send the Soyuz in LLO, then :
a) The Soyuz docks the LM and power it up (fuel cells plugged or switched on).
b) Crew transfer to man the LM.
c) The manned LM performs a rendez-vous & docking with the orbiting Fregat.
d) The Fregat brakes the LM until the final landing phase.
e) While in free fall, the LM undocks and perform an avoidance manoeuver.
f) The LM lits its engine. Final landing phase : the pilot has to show its skills !
g) Lunar Landing and EVA.
h) Liftoff ! The legs and the chassis that supports them stay on the Moon.
i) The LM achieves LLO (no more than 30-40 kms of altitude are needed).
j) The LM burns its last drops of fuel to perform a rendez-vous & docking with the Soyuz.
k) Undocking.
l) The Soyuz performs a rendez-vous with Fregat2.
m) TEI
n) MCC
o) Reentry
p) Landing & recovery (at least !)
